just-react
just-react copied to clipboard
react 为什么使用深度优先遍历构建fiber树 而不是广度优先呢
react 为什么使用深度优先遍历构建fiber树 而不是广度优先呢
相较之深度优先遍历, 广度优先遍历需要开辟额外的内存来记录一些状态变量。而且对于深度优先来说, fiberNode这种链表节点本来就是为深度遍历/回溯 这种场景设计的吧